Understanding Sash Windows
Sash windows make up two or more movable panels (or "sashes") that move vertically within a frame. They are usually constructed from timber, although contemporary options, such as uPVC, are likewise offered. The main factors house owners invest in sash window renovations include:
Preservation of Historical Aesthetic: Maintaining the initial style of a home.Improved Energy Efficiency: Enhancing insulation to minimize energy expenses.Increased Property Value: Well-maintained windows can increase a property's market appeal.Removal of Draughts: Addressing air leakages that trigger discomfort.Benefits of Sash Window Renovation
Remodeling sash windows provides several advantages over complete replacements:
Cost-Effectiveness: Renovation generally costs less than complete replacement, saving homeowners money while enhancing residential or commercial property worth.Sustainability: Renovation lessens waste by recycling existing products, aligning with contemporary environment-friendly practices.Historical Integrity: Preserving original features maintains the character of historical homes, which is necessary for areas governed by conservation laws.Personalization: Renovators can offer custom solutions customized to the specific needs and design choices of the property owner.The Renovation Process
The renovation process for sash windows normally consists of a number of essential stages, performed by specialists who possess the essential competence. A typical renovation might include the following actions:

Assessment and Consultation:
A comprehensive examination of the condition of the sash windows to identify issues such as rot, misalignment, and draftiness.Discussion with the property owner relating to specific needs and preferences.
Restoration of Existing Frames:
Repairing or replacing damaged areas of the wood.Treatment for pests or rot to extend the lifespan of the windows.
Sash Repair and Glazing:
Ensuring that sashes are properly weighted and slide efficiently.Upgrading or replacing glazing to enhance energy performance, which may involve installing double-glazing units.
Completing Touches:
Sanding and painting the frames to restore their visual appeal.Fitting weatherstripping to boost insulation and get rid of draughts.Picking the Right Specialist

For how long does the sash window renovation process take?
The timeframe for sash window renovation can vary depending upon the extent of the work required. Typically, a complete renovation can take anywhere from a couple of days to a couple of weeks.
2. Can I carry out sash window renovations myself?
While minor repairs may be workable for DIY lovers, it is normally a good idea to employ professionals for comprehensive renovations to make sure quality work and compliance with Local Sash Window Restoration Experts guidelines.
3. What materials are best for sash window renovation?
Typically, timber is the preferred product due to its visual appeal and historical value. Modern choices, such as top quality uPVC, can likewise be used, particularly in non-listed properties.
4. Are grants readily available for sash window renovations?
Particular heritage companies and local councils may use grants or rewards for the restoration of historical properties. Homeowners must look for offered programs in their location.
5. How can I ensure that my refurbished sash windows are energy-efficient?
Consulting with specialists who use contemporary techniques and products-- such as double glazing and weatherstripping-- can significantly boost the energy effectiveness of renovated sash windows.
